Incorporating Flossing Into Your Routine



Start consisting of flossing in your daily oral care regimen to enhance the health of your gums and teeth. Flossing aids remove plaque and food fragments that your tooth brush may not reach, avoiding gum tissue condition and dental caries.

To include flossing successfully, start by using about 18 inches of floss and winding it around your center fingers, leaving a couple of inches to deal with. Delicately glide the floss between your teeth using a back-and-forth activity, making sure to curve it around the base of each tooth. Beware not to break the floss right into your periodontals, as this can trigger inflammation.

Aim to floss a minimum of once daily, preferably prior to bedtime, to get rid of germs and debris that accumulate throughout the day. By making flossing a habit, you can considerably boost your oral health and wellness, leading to a brighter smile and fresher breath.

Perks of Regular Oral Check-ups



Including routine oral check-ups into your dental care routine is critical for keeping optimal dental wellness and protecting against potential issues. By arranging these consultations every six months, you can gain from professional cleansing to remove plaque and tartar buildup that routine brushing might miss out on.

Throughout these examinations, your dental practitioner can also examine your teeth and gum tissues for any type of indicators of decay, gum tissue illness, or various other oral health problems. Early discovery of concerns can cause less complex and much less costly therapies.

Furthermore, routine oral check-ups can aid in identifying problems that may not be causing signs and symptoms yet, such as dental caries or early stages of gum illness. By dealing with these troubles early, you can prevent them from progressing into much more extreme conditions that might need considerable therapy.



Additionally, dental check-ups provide a possibility for your dental expert to provide tailored recommendations on proper dental hygiene techniques and find any kind of indications of dental cancer. Focusing on these routine brows through can ultimately save you time, cash, and potential discomfort in the long run.
